WebMar 24, 2024 · The berries of asparagus fern are toxic to cats and dogs. The berries also can irritate human skin on contact, and cause stomach upset if eaten. In spring and summer, keep the compost moist but not soggy – allowing any excess to drain away. Reduce watering in autumn, and water more sparingly in winter. Edible ferns can be delicious but need to be boiled or steamed to become safe to eat. Ostrich ferns are believed to be the tastiest and safest to eat. The fern is usually recognisable by the silver-white colour of the under-surface of mature fronds.
